Place the power bank in an area where the solar panels can receive maximum exposure to the suns rays.
Avoid shaded areas or places where the panels may be blocked by objects like trees or buildings.
This will ensure optimal absorption of sunlight and maximize the charging efficiency.
ensure the connections are secure to ensure a stable charging process.
4.Monitor the charging progress:Most Blavor Solar Power Banks feature LED indicator lights that display the charging status.
Check the indicators regularly to track the progress of the charging process.
The lights may vary in color or blink to indicate the power banks current charge level.
The charging speed will also depend on factors like the power banks capacity and the strength of the sunlight.
Its essential to be patient and allow sufficient time for the power bank to charge fully.
